You'd have to be insane...
...to use an open access point.
By using one you're giving the owner of the WAP free view of all your network traffic: including unencrypted passwords you might use to log in to your banking etc web sites.
Second the operator of the WAP can re-direct you to any sites he wants, even ones that appear to be what you wanted but aren't.
And you're not safe if you use a paid for WAP either: you've might just have given your payment details to a crook.
